Am 18.06.2015 um 20:08 schrieb Karl-Friedrich Ratzsch:
>
> For axis labels, there is a provision for automatic ki, Mi, Ti
> notation, check "help format specifiers".
>
> Otherwise you can build your own function returning the proper prefixes:
>
> fstring(x) = sprintf("%.f ",\
> x<2**10 ? (ps="",x) :\
> x<2**20 ? (ps="Ki", x/2**10) : \
> x<2**30 ? (ps="Mi", x/2**20) :\
> (ps="Ti", x/2**30)).ps."Byte"
>
or use gnuplots gprintf() function that knows the "%b %B" format
